Descripción del empleo

Overview

Develop and execute strategies for efficient inventory management, including demand planning, material procurement, and storage. Ensure the availability of materials required for production and other operations while minimizing the risk of supply disruptions. Implement inventory management systems to optimize inventory levels and reduce associated costs. Manage the supply chain, including coordination with suppliers, carriers, and logistics partners. Implement and improve logistics and materials management processes to increase efficiency and reduce costs. Apply continuous improvement methodologies (such as Lean and Six Sigma) to identify and eliminate inefficiencies throughout the supply chain. Select, evaluate, and manage relationships with material suppliers and logistics service providers. Negotiate supplier contracts and agreements to ensure competitive pricing and high-quality supply. Develop and manage the Materials and Logistics department budget. Monitor and control operating costs, identifying opportunities for cost reduction without compromising service quality. Ensure compliance with local and international regulations governing materials management and logistics. Implement safe and sustainable practices for material handling and transportation. Oversee the implementation and maintenance of technology systems used for inventory and logistics management, including ERP and WMS platforms. Lead, coach, and develop the Materials and Logistics team through training, guidance, and ongoing support. Foster a collaborative, results-oriented work environment. Collaborate with other departments, including Production and Engineering, to align materials and logistics activities with overall business objectives. Comply with and enforce Environmental, Health, and Safety (EHS) policies and procedures in accordance with established company procedures, standards, and applicable Mexican Official Standards (NOMs).
